Do you know that Mark Lester didn't really sing in the film version. His voice was dubbed with the voice of the Producer's or Director's daughter (can't remember which one). He couldn't sing a note.

My favourite song is Consider yourself. Jack whotsiname was great. He was just turning his life around when he got throat cancer.

Davy Jones of the Monkees played the Dodger in the Broadway production before he joined the Monkees. There was a clip of it on YouTube a while ago.
